Welcome to Homegrown/Homemade, a video series from FineGardening.com and our sister site FineCooking.com. We're following a gardener (Danielle Sherry) and a cook (Sarah Breckenridge) as they plant, maintain, harvest, store, and prepare garden vegetables under the watchful eye of Juno, Sarah's inquisitive dog.

As new videos become available, we'll be posting links to them here. Click on the images or the titles in the box to see any or all the videos.
